Senator Arlen Specter stopped being the only Jewish Republican in the U.S. Senate earlier this year, and instead become the umpteenth Jewish Democrat in the U.S. Senate, in a somewhat desperate bid to hold on to his Pennsylvania seat. (He was pretty sure to lose a Republican primary challenge from the right.) Well, it doesn’t look like the gambit is working. In early may, the 79-year-old incumbent held as 53-33 lead over that conservative challenger, Rep. Pat Toomey. According to a Quinnipiac poll yesterday, that lead is down to 45-44.
